Improving Order Accuracy with Automated Shipping
Manual shipping processes can be prone to errors, which can result in unhappy customers and lost sales. Automated shipping software can help reduce the likelihood of errors by automating order processing, label printing, and package tracking. By using barcodes and scanners to track packages throughout the shipping process, businesses can ensure that orders are delivered accurately and on time.

Choosing the Right Automation Tools for Your Business Needs
There are a variety of automated shipping tools available, ranging from simple label printing software to full-scale shipping management systems. When selecting automation tools, it’s important to consider the specific needs of your business, including shipping volume, carrier preferences, and regulatory requirements. Working with a vendor who specializes in food and beverage shipping can be helpful in identifying the right tools for your business.
Another important factor to consider when choosing automation tools is the level of integration with your existing systems. If you already have an inventory management system in place, for example, you’ll want to ensure that your shipping automation tools can seamlessly integrate with it. This can help streamline your operations and reduce the risk of errors or delays.
It’s also worth considering the level of support and training that’s available with your chosen automation tools. While some tools may be relatively easy to use, others may require more extensive training or ongoing support. Make sure you understand what kind of support is available, and factor this into your decision-making process.
